The voice of dissent
We have heard much about the PIGS but there are consequences for allowing your country to fail economically and they might just descend elsewhere. A new party is rising in Germany calling for Germany to abandon the Euro and by coincidence, the bailout of the failing european states
Anti-euro party a wildcard in German elections - World news
This movement is in its infancy and its leadership isn't charismatic but there is a danger in german politics should the voices of reason and unity be replaced. Let us not forget, economic failure in Europe has consequences for the rest of us, consequences that we are unable to calculate. It seems the reasons for strong regulation of banking and financial systems are ever present
